On what days will banks be closed due to holidays?


Banking institutions will closed on four days due to holidays Christmas, New Year and Epiphany.

According to information from Greek Banking Associationbanks will be closed on the following days:

  • On Christmas day, in Wednesday, December 25
  • On the second day of Christmas, in Thursday, December 26
  • On New Year's Day, in Wednesday, January 1
  • On the day of Epiphany, in Monday, January 6th.

It should be noted that banks will open on the second day New Year (Thursday January 2).

In two days, the holiday opening hours of Greek stores will start

Formerly the Athens Chamber of Commerce reported about the holiday opening hours of commercial stores:

  • Monday, December 23, 09:00-21:00
  • Tuesday, December 24, 09:00-21:00
  • Wednesday, December 25 closed
  • Thursday, December 26th closed
  • Friday, December 27, 09:00-21:00
  • Saturday, December 28, 09:00-21:00
  • Sunday, December 29, 11:00-18:00
  • Monday, December 30, 09:00-21:00
  • Tuesday, December 31, 09:00-18:00
  • Wednesday, January 1, closed
  • Thursday, January 2, closed.
